Output e5acf778ee9390903f5936fa26a2f3ec4c5dcac747d16c81bf42ae4ee45f050a:0

value
14813447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43dc6a5263fd30064995ed1fdf3b680be1c0621d OP_EQUAL
address
37sqF7zGVoSv1mGaKVeAp3avKjadveJwcQ
transaction
e5acf778ee9390903f5936fa26a2f3ec4c5dcac747d16c81bf42ae4ee45f050a
spent
true